- the invention relates to a cleaning system with a wringer for a mop cover of a flat wiper with a handle which comprises a downwardly conically tapered, substantially funnel-shaped Auswringschacht with mating surfaces, in which the mop cover at substantially vertical position of the wiper plate, partially detached from this and hanging down, inserted from above and can be pressed by pressure on the handle, wherein the wiper plate for squeezing at least partially in the Auswringschacht is inserted, so that their downwardly directed end face forms a contact surface.
- the flat wiper has a handle and a wiper plate, which is connected to the handle via a connecting element with joint on.
- a clamping device for fastening a mop cover is arranged in the front area of the wiper plate seen in the wiping direction.
- the flat wiper is lifted with wiper plate from the ground, the wiper plate folds down in a vertical position and the only fixed to the front edge of the wiper plate mop vertically sags down.
- the mop cover is now inserted in this position perpendicularly from above into the conically widening towards the bottom Auswringkorb, where he puts in wrinkles.
- the mop cover is pressed out over the downwardly facing end face of the wiper plate in the wringing basket.
- a disadvantage of the known cleaning device that the mop cover must be placed very carefully when inserted into the Auswringkorb to come to the desired folding. Parts of the mop cover, which are not below the contact surface, but laterally on the inner wall of the Auswringschachts come to rest, are not squeezed.
- the object of the invention is to provide a cleaning system in which the mop cover when inserting into the Auswringschacht is inevitably brought into the optimum for squeezing position, without requiring special handling by the user or that the risk of tipping of the wringer bearing Container exists.
- the cleaning system is to provide a flat wiper and a wringer in which flat wiper and wringer are coordinated so that the wringing is carried out in a simple and efficient manner, on the other hand, the flat wiper is not affected by the adaptation to the wringer in its function.
- the wringer for a flat wiper which comprises a downwardly conically tapered, substantially funnel-shaped Auswringschacht with mating pressing surfaces in which the mop cover at substantially vertical position of the wiper plate, partially detached from this and hanging down from can be inserted above and pressed out by pressure on the handle, wherein the wiper plate for pressing at least partially inserted into the Auswringschacht so that the downwardly facing end face forms a contact surface, means for stabilizing the wiper plate against tilting during insertion and squeezing in Wringing shaft provided.
- the means for stabilizing a wiper plate comprise two mutually opposite first inner walls of the wringing out or first guide elements, in particular vertically extending, rib-like elevations, on these first inner walls and on at least one of the two first inner walls nor second guide elements.
- the wiper plate is supported during insertion into the Auswringschacht with their larger surfaces and it is achieved a particularly secure guidance.

- FIG. 1 a wringer 1 with Auswringschacht 2 with opposite inner walls 7 a, 7 b and 8 a, 8 b.
- the Auswringschacht 2 has a downwardly conically tapered, substantially funnel-shaped shape. In the lower area are the counter-pressing surfaces and outlet openings 3 for discharging the pressed out of the mop cover cleaning liquid.
- guide elements 4a are still visible, on which corresponding counter-guide elements are supported on the wiper plate.
- the Auswringschacht 1 closes at the top an introduction funnel 5 at. This widens conically towards the top and serves as an insertion aid for the mop cover with wiper plate.
- FIG. 1 The wringer out FIG. 1 is preferably used for a flat wiper, as in FIG. 2 is shown.
- FIG. 2 the mop head of such a flat wiper.
- the two-part wiper plate 10 consists of axes 18 a, 18 b against each other pivotable plate wings 10 a, 10 b, at the lower ends of the retaining tabs 20 b of the mop cover 20 are releasably secured by a hook and loop fastener.
- FIG. 2 the mop head of such a flat wiper.
- the two-part wiper plate 10 consists of axes 18 a, 18 b against each other pivotable plate wings 10 a, 10 b, at the lower ends of the retaining tabs 20 b of the mop cover 20 are releasably secured by a hook and loop fastener.
- the mop cover is in Auspresswolf.
- the middle piece 11 has, as from FIG. 3 it can be seen on the bottom of a functional surface 12, which is formed in the illustrated embodiment without loss of generality so that it serves to remove stubborn contaminants.
- the functional surface 12 can be actuated by pressure on the handle 30.
- FIG. 4 shows the operation of the wringer 1 from FIG. 1 for a cleaning system according to the invention.
- the wiper plate 10 in folded down, vertical position of the plate wings 10 a, 10 b with loop-shaped down by hanging mop cover 20 already partially inserted into the wringing device 1. It can be seen that the mop cover 20 is already partially in the wringing shaft 2 of the wringing device 1. The mop cover 20 is pushed so far into the Auswringschacht 2 until it touches the bottom area with counterpressure surfaces.
- the wiper plate 10 For wiping the mop cover 20, the wiper plate 10 is then pushed by applying a force on the handle 30 in the Auswringschacht 2, wherein its lower end surface compresses the squeegee 20 and squeezes out.
- the wiper plate When inserted into the Auswringschacht 2, the wiper plate is supported with the tops 10 a, 10 b of their folded down plate leaf on the inner walls 7 a, 7 b of the Auswringschachts 2 and is thus stabilized against tilting in the direction of these walls.
- the wiper plate 10 Upon further insertion, the wiper plate 10 is further supported with its counter guide elements 4 b on the corresponding guide elements 4 a on the inner wall 7 a of the Auswringschachts 2 against tilting in the direction of the walls 8 a, 8 b of the Auswringschachts 2 down.
- the wiper plate 10 is thereby guided safely and stably during the wringing out in the wringing shaft.

- Cleaning system, comprising a flat wiper with a handle (30), a wiper plate (10) and a wiping cloth (20) which can be fastened releasably to the wiper plate (10), and comprising a wringing device (1), wherein the wringing device (1) comprises a substantially funnel-shaped wringing shaft (2) which tapers conically downwards and has counter pressing surfaces, wherein the wiping cloth (20) is partially released from the wiper plate (10), when the latter is in a substantially vertical position, and, hanging downwards, can be inserted from above into the wringing shaft (2) and can be squeezed out by pressure being applied to the handle (30), wherein, for the squeezing-out operation, the wiper plate (10) can be at least partially inserted at the same time into the wringing shaft (2) such that the downwardly directed end surface of said wiper blade forms a press-on surface, wherein devices for stabilizing the wiper plate (10) against tilting in a first plane are provided, said devices comprising two mutually opposite first inner walls (7a, 7b) of the wringing shaft (2) or first guide elements on said first inner walls (7a, 7b), wherein the distance of said guide elements from each other is dimensioned in such a manner that, upon insertion into the wringing shaft (2), the wiper plate (10) is supported on both inner walls (7a, 7b) or on the inner walls (7a, 7b) at the first guide elements fitted on both sides, or is simultaneously supported on both sides on one of the two inner walls (7a, 7b) at the first guide elements and on the other inner wall, characterized in that, for the purpose of stabilizing against tilting in a second plane perpendicular to the first plane, second guide elements (4a) are also provided on at least one of the two first inner walls (7a, 7b) and corresponding mating guide elements (4b) on the wiper plate (10) are supported on said second guide elements (4a).
- Cleaning system according to Claim 1, wherein the upper end of the wringing shaft (2) has an insertion funnel (5) which becomes much wider upwards.
- Cleaning system according to either of Claims 1 and 2, wherein the wringing shaft (2) has outlet openings (3) in the lower region and in the shaft base.
- Cleaning system according to Claim 3, wherein the outlet openings (3) are groove-shaped apertures (3).
- Cleaning system according to one of Claims 1 to 4, wherein the counter pressing surfaces have raised regions in order to increase the squeezing-out pressure.
- Cleaning system according to Claim 5, wherein the shaft base has rib-like elevations.
- Cleaning system according to one of the preceding claims, wherein the upper region of the wringing shaft (2) has two mutually opposite, substantially rectangular apertures (6) which, upon insertion of the wiper plate (10) into the wringing shaft (2), can be reached through by the two ends of a central part (11) of the wiper plate (10), which central part is connected fixedly to the handle (30).
- Cleaning system according to one of the preceding claims, wherein the height of the wringing shaft (2) is dimensioned in such a manner that at least the lower end of the vertically aligned wiper plate (10) is in engagement with the devices for stabilizing the wiper plate (10) against tilting even as the wiping cloth (20) touches the base of the wringing device (1).
- Cleaning system according to one of the preceding claims, wherein the flat wiper has a two-part wiper plate (10) with two plate wings (10a, 10b), which are foldable to each other, and with a wiping cloth (20) which can be fastened releasably to the two outwardly pointing ends of the plate wings (10a, 10b), and in that, for wringing-out purposes, the plate wings (10a, 10b) can be folded downwards into a substantially vertical, parallel position, with the wiping cloth (20) sagging downwards in a loop-shaped manner.
- Cleaning system according to Claim 9, wherein the wiper plate (10) is foldable along the shorter transverse axis thereof.
